In History. Since Texas had slaves prior to being admitted to the Union, it became a slave state by being admitted to the Union with no restriction on what was an already existing practice. The likelihood of Texas joining the Union as a slave state delayed any formal action by the U.S. Congress for more than a decade. Polk won the election of 1844 and was the United States President when Texas joined the USA. The country was known as the Republic of Texas. The United States House and Senate, in turn, accepted the Texas state constitution in a Joint Resolution to Admit Texas as a State which was signed by the president on December 29, 1845.
